I am Thai, living in Thailand. Would like to go skiing in Harbin in Jan 2010 but not sure what is the nearest airport or where should I land. Is there any direct flight from Bangkok to Harbin? Or do I have to go thru another city? If so , which city am I suppose to make the transit ? And what is the cheapest flight i could get? Please reply to nectar1811@yahoo.com

looking forward to hearing from you soon.

Sep. 20,2009 04:16
Mr.Clark replied:

No direct flight from Bangkok to Harbin. You should get to Beijing first and then change another flight or take bulle train to Harbin. There are flights by Air China, Thai Airways International, Bangkok Airway and Air Lanka. You can make a inquiry to the airlines and make a comparison.
